Academic Centers of Excellence for Model-informed drug development (MIDD)

As regulators and sponsors recognize the growing importance of model-informed drug development (MIDD), Certara is committed to educating the next generation of experts in this field, on a global basis. We are achieving that goal by partnering with eminent scientists at designated academic Centers of Excellence around the world.

Our Centers of Excellence program is designed to:

  • Build a reputation for researching and discovering new solutions and solve PK/PD challenges
  • Provide faculty, students, and post-doctoral researchers the use of innovative software solutions to research, test, and apply problem solving
  • Remain at the forefront of new technology trends and breakthroughs
  • Lead the way from initial ideas in software development to the implementation of cutting-edge technologies
  • Participate in pre-release testing of emerging technologies, enabling our Center of Excellence experts to stay abreast of software development and, when applicable, influence the outcome.

As a participant in the Centers of Excellence program, Certara provides access to Phoenix software licenses (at no cost) to be used by faculty, students, and post-doctoral researchers to support coursework, academic research, and collaboration on other projects with Certara. In return, we ask that the Center of Excellence contribute public webinars that cover topics related to the Phoenix software or the use of that software to solve a problem, public recognition on websites, inclusion of training on Phoenix software in student courses, and referencing Phoenix software in academic publications.
